Output 3b6051d9e617fb13e4a3a1caf1e776a8249098253e3dde48083efb3ab505b3d3:1

value
26880490
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45db34f7886fa83f3fadf6ab61fcdb687633dcf4 OP_EQUAL
address
384P9YRdTAZzrioVTBFcEqmTinS9WW1dk6
transaction
3b6051d9e617fb13e4a3a1caf1e776a8249098253e3dde48083efb3ab505b3d3
confirmations
94130
spent
true